Abstract
In this paper, we use PCI pass-through technology and make the virtual machines in a virtual environment are able to use the NVIDIA graphics card, which uses the CUDA parallel programming. It makes the virtual machine have not only the virtual CPU but also the real GPU for computing. The performance of virtual machine is predicted to increase dramatically. This paper will measure the performance differences between virtual machines and physical machines by using CUDA; and how virtual machines would verify CPU numbers under influence of CUDA performance. At last, we compare two open source virtualization environment hypervisor, whether it is after PCI pass-through CUDA performance differences or not. Through the experiment, we will be able to know which environment will reach the best efficiency in a virtual environment by using CUDA.
